Rising interest rates have begun to slow an overheated housing market as monthly mortgage payments have risen dramatically since the beginning of the year. .: This is leaving some people, who want to purchase a home, priced out of the market, and others wondering if now is the right time to buy.But this rise in borrowing cost shows no signs of letting up soon.

Economic uncertainty and the volatility of the financial markets are causing mortgage rates to rise George Ratiu, Senior Economist and Manager of Economic Research at realtor com, says this:

“While even two months ago rates above 7% may have seemed unthinkable, at the current pace, we can expect rates to surpass that level in the next three months ”

Alameda

What's in the Alameda data?

In Alameda, the median sold price for single-family homes in September increased month-over-month to $1.4 million. The number of homes sold decreased to 32, and the number of new listings increased to 82. The number of condo & townhome sales decreased to $875 thousand month-over-month with 17 units sold and 52 new listings. Alameda

SEPTEMBER 2021 - SEPTEMBER 2022

Single Family Homes

Last 12 months, year-over-year.

Condos & Townhomes

Last 12 months, year-over-year

Single Family Homes

The median sales price has increased from $1.3m last September 2021 to $1.4m in September 2022.

Condos & Townhomes

The median sales price has decreased from $952k last September 2021 to $875k in September 2022.

Single Family Homes

The average days on market is from 13 days last September 2021 up to 24 days by September 2022

Condos & Townhomes

The average days on market last September 2021 is 16 days up to 32 days in September 2022

Overbids

Single Family Homes

The overbid percentage has decreased from 118.4% last September 2021 to 108.4% a year later.

Condos & Townhomes

The overbid percentage has decreased from 109% last September 2021 to 105.2% a year later.
